Job description

Role Overview

As the Senior Financial Analyst, Corporate FP&A - Capital Management, you will play a critical role in building and scaling our global capital management function. This is a high‑impact role focused on developing the processes, tools, and governance that support capital planning, investment decisions, and performance tracking across the business.

You will act as a strategic partner to Finance, Regional teams, and Business Leaders, helping drive transparency, accountability, and optimized capital allocation across Arc’teryx. This role is ideal for someone who thrives in ambiguity, enjoys building from the ground up, and wants to influence how capital is deployed in a fast‑growing global organization.

This role is based out of our North Vancouver office and is open to hybrid remote work. Candidates must be eligible to work in Canada.

Team

The Corporate FP&A team provides leadership, clarity, and direction on financial planning, forecasting, and reporting across Arc’teryx. Within this team, Capital Management is an evolving strategic capability focused on ensuring disciplined investment, strong governance, and clear insight into capital investment.

You will work closely with FP&A, Accounting, Systems, and business stakeholders globally to build scalable solutions and elevate capital planning maturity.

Responsibilities

  • Capital Planning & Governance:
    • Partnering with business and regional teams to support capital budgeting and forecasting cycles, including the global consolidation of capital forecasts.
    • Developing and maintaining planning templates, methodologies, and timelines.
  • Capital Reporting & Insights:
    • Building and maintaining capital reporting frameworks and improving forecast accuracy through variance analysis and actionable insights.
    • Delivering monthly and quarterly reporting on capital spend, project performance, and key variances, and supporting executive reporting on capital investments.
    • Partnering with Arc’teryx Accounting and Amer Global Accounting/Finance team to understand monthly actuals vs plan.
    • Supporting the build‑out of system Capital Reporting in OneStream.
    • Developing financial models and dashboards to support capital planning and reporting.
    • Supporting business partners and functions in establishing controls and processes related to capital spending.
    • Driving initiatives that increase stakeholder ownership and accountability for operational spending.
    • Owning and maintaining depreciation models, ensuring alignment with financial forecasts and accounting requirements.
    • Continuously identifying opportunities to improve FP&A and capital management processes.
    • Supporting the broader Corporate FP&A In‑Year Planning team, including quarterly forecast and annual budget cycles, and creation of processes.

Qualifications

  • 4+ years proven experience in Financial Planning and Analysis, with capital experience an asset.
  • A bachelor’s degree in finance/accounting or equivalent and, ideally, a CPA, CMA, CA, CFA.
  • Exceptional attention to detail.
  • Ability to coordinate and lead projects to completion.
  • Experience with capital planning, reporting and consolidation.
  • Advanced financial modeling skills, including experience with depreciation and investment analysis.
  • Advanced analytical skills with strong aptitude for MS Excel and experience with OneStream or Oracle ERP.
  • Experience in project management and can prioritize and manage multiple tasks within tight deadlines.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ills and ability to collaborate with individuals across departments, organizations, and countries.
  • Proactive in identifying the root cause of issues and developing solutions.
  • Highly flexible and adaptable when faced with ambiguity.
  • Can balance autonomy and collaboration.
  • Inspire breakthrough thinking and continuous improvement.
  • Seek the best (but sometimes not the easiest) solutions, with an unwavering commitment.
  • Passion for work and for getting outside and living it.

Compensation & Benefits

Compensation: salary range CAD$94,000 - CAD$123,000. The range reflects market alignment and scope of the role. Individual pay is determined by your skills, experience, and level of responsibility.

Benefits:

  • Health & wellbeing – Extended health, dental, and vision coverage, including mental health support, fertility benefits, gender‑affirming care and a 24/7 Employee Assistance Program (EAP).
  • Financial wellbeing – RRSP matching and eligibility for Arc’teryx Annual Incentive Plan and Employee Stock Purchase Program (ESPP) where applicable.
  • Time & flexibility – Paid time off, wellness time, and No Wasted Day program (dedicated paid days to get outside & explore).
  • Family support – Parental leave top‑up and a nesting period for new parents.
  • Growth, community & gear – Professional development opportunities, Arc’teryx Academies (outdoor skill‑building events), Employee Belonging Councils, and access to employee discounts and Pro Deals.
